A Tylenchulus sp. found in a Georgia peach orchard parasitized peach roots in the greenhouse. Citrus roots were not parasitized, indicating that the nematode was not the citrus nematode. Morphologically similar populations were found in one peach orchard in Alabama, two orchards in Arkansas, and one in South Carolina. Penetration of second-stage juveniles (J2) of Meloidogyne incognita into tomato root explants and in vitro propagated peach plantlet roots were compared. Five inoculum levels were used: 25, 50, 75, 100, and 200 J2 for tomato; and 50, 100, 200, 500, and 1,000J2 for peach. New foreign rootstocks for peaches [Prunus persica (L.) Batsch] are now being introduced into the United States through commercial nurseries for future sales to stone fruit growers. Almost all of these rootstocks are complex Prunus L. hybrids that are propagated vegetatively. Background IgE-mediated allergy to peach represents a frequent cause of severe anaphylactic reactions in Mediterranean countries. Pru p 3, a nonspecific lipid transfer protein (LTP) from peach, was identified as an important elicitor of IgEmediated food hypersensitivity reactions to peach. TCP-Peach has recently been proposed for IP network scenarios characterized by long round trip times and high bit error rates, such as satellite networks. In the TCPPeach congestion control scheme, Slow Start and Fast Recovery are replaced with new algorithms called Sudden Start and Rapid Recovery. Experiments were conducted to investigate the effects of low temperatures on anthocyanin accumulation in apple and peach shoots. The anthocyanin concentration in both the apple and peach shoots increased rapidly during cold acclimation reaching the peak value in early December.
